Agility is a crucial aspect of many sports and activities, demanding both speed and coordination. Reflex agility, specifically, refers to the ability to react swiftly and accurately to stimuli. Through dedicated drills, individuals can significantly enhance their reflex agility, leading to improved performance in various fields.
One successful method for boosting reflex agility is through reaction drills. These exercises involve responding to unexpected visual or auditory cues with swift and precise movements. By repeatedly engaging in these drills, the brain adapts to process information faster and trigger appropriate responses more efficiently.
Additionally, incorporating diverse activities like boxing into your routine can contribute to enhanced reflex agility. These pursuits often demand quick reflexes, hand-eye coordination, and the ability to react to changing situations, further sharpening these essential skills.
- Frequently engaging in reflex agility drills can lead to noticeable improvements in your overall performance.
- Pay attention on maintaining proper form and technique during each drill for optimal results.
- Challenge yourself by gradually increasing the difficulty of the drills as you progress.
